logo

Output 7572bfa8e42d41911d51fe58861ed6a22a1949686ee210f804a57ae1cdf90bf3:1

value
38517302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ebc7e066b0ef2cb2d85eca1f95fb9bda96748fc OP_EQUAL
address
3DF8sPTQxz8CGpYLF3F5Bx4hAZAJwZ272H
transaction
7572bfa8e42d41911d51fe58861ed6a22a1949686ee210f804a57ae1cdf90bf3